Timelapse
You can make a Timelapse video from any document you’ve ever made in Flow. Yep, even ones you drew a few years ago!
- Open the document you want to turn into a timelapse
- Tap export then choose Timelapse Video, Timelapse GIF or Timelapse Image Sequence
- Choose options
- Share!

Import and Export PDF
You can now import and export PDFs in Flow. Quickly insert a document, mark out some changes and then send it back. Easy peasy!
- Tap the Insert button and select Add from files
- Choose your PDF then place it on the page
- Draw over top
- Tap the export button and choose Entire Document
Done! It’s such a simple way to mark out changes in a fixed document.
Realtime Collaboration
Did you know you can collaborate with other people in Flow? Multiple people can work on the same document simultaneously from separate devices wherever they are in the world. You can share work documents with colleagues across the country or play Noughts and Crosses with your niece down the road.
Here’s how it works:
- Tap the collaboration button on any document and choose Draw with others or SharePlay to immediately start a FaceTime call
- Send the link to who you’d like to share with
- Draw together!
If the other person doesn’t have a compatible device (iPad, iPhone) then you can also choose to record your screen or broadcast via apps such as Zoom.
